    Actor, writer, director and producer Nicolas Dozol studied cinema at the Conservatoire Libre du Cinéma Français (CLCF). He has since directed 10 short films, and released his debut feature Last Party (which he also wrote and produced) earlier this year at the Chelsea Film Festival. Victoria Luxford, who interviews him, describes Dozol’s latest creation as a film with “a lot of ambition, turning the high school/teen drama on its head”.

    Based on the eponymous novel by Li Xiuwen, Bound in Heaven takes place in Chinese cities of Shanghai, Wuhan and Chongqing. during the early teens of this century. The landscape is unforgivingly urban, with a succession of skyscrapers offering the two leads very little respite. This is a country growing taller and faster than its inhabitants, who often struggle to find a meaning to their increasingly menial and anonymous existence.
